Progress Studies: Ask that your attorney hold you knowledgeable of the progress of your case in response to a pre-established schedule. Remember that many overseas courts work more slowly than courts within the United States. You could, therefore, wish the attorney to ship you month-to-month reviews, regardless that no actual developments have ensured, simply to fulfill your questions about the progress of the case. Ask what the price can be for progress reviews.

Specifically, a criminal defense attorney defends those that have been accused of a prison offense. A prison defense attorney prepares a case in an attempt to protect their purchasers’ civil liberties and have them declared not guilty. In lieu of that, a criminal defense attorney will try to have the sentence given be as light as attainable.

The median annual wage for lawyers was $a hundred and twenty,910 in Might 2018. The median wage is the wage at which half the workers in an occupation earned greater than that amount and half earned much less. The bottom 10 percent earned less than $fifty eight,220, and the highest 10 % earned greater than $208,000.

Tax lawyers handle quite a lot of tax-associated points for people and companies. They could help purchasers navigate advanced tax regulations, so that purchasers pay the suitable tax on items such as revenue, income, and property. For example, tax lawyers could advise a corporation on how much tax it needs to pay from income made in several states in an effort to comply with Inner Revenue Service (IRS) guidelines.
